Unfortunately, Belarc is not freeware. From <file://C:\Program
Files\Belarc\Advisor\System\local\license.txt>:
1. Notice
The Belarc Client ("Client") is a unique plug-in extension that works
with your Internet browser. It automatically shows your installed
software and hardware. This Client is for personal use only.
The Client, or any output from it, may not be used for commercial,
educational or government purposes or to aggregate information about
multiple computers. Licensing information for those purposes is
available at http://www.belarc.com or by calling Belarc
at +1-978-461-1103.
